2. Pharrell's Family Heritage
Pharrell was born on April 5, 1973, in Virginia Beach, Virginia. His family's cultural background has greatly influenced his upbringing and artistic vision.
Pharrell's Parents and Their Influence
Pharrell's mother, Carrie Williams, was a teacher, and his father, Pharrell Williams Sr., was a handyman. They instilled in him a strong work ethic and a deep appreciation for the arts. Growing up in a supportive environment allowed Pharrell to explore his creativity from a young age.
